Hmm, it's good that you mention this. When explaining directories to friends used to Windows (and GUI) terms, I noticed that it's unfamiliar to them. I actually thought about it, and the term "directory" tells you what it is quite precisely: Like a directory of phones, it's just a piece of paper where you note down the phones of people. Directories, similarly, contain lists of files. They don't "hold" nor "contain" the files.
